Message type: E = Error
Message class: /ISDFPS/MISC -
Message number: 628
Message text: Error while reading the equipment packages for force element &1 &2

/ISDFPS/MISC628
- Error while reading the equipment packages for force element &1 &2 ?The SAP error message
/ISDFPS/MISC628
indicates that there is an issue while reading the equipment packages for a specific force element. This error typically arises in the context of SAP's Industry Solution for Defense Forces and Security (ISDFPS), particularly when dealing with equipment management and logistics.Cause:
The error can be caused by several factors, including:
Missing or Incomplete Data: The force element specified in the error message may not have the necessary equipment packages assigned to it, or the data may be incomplete or corrupted.
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ues in the system that prevent the proper reading of equipment packages.
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the equipment packages related to the specified force element.
Technical Issues: There could be underlying technical issues, such as database inconsistencies or problems with the SAP application itself.
Solution:
To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:
Check Data Consistency:
- Verify that the force element specified in the error message has the correct and complete equipment packages assigned to it.
- Use transaction codes like
IE03
(Display Equipment) orIL03
(Display Functional Location) to check the details.Review Configuration:
- Ensure that the configuration settings for the equipment packages and force elements are correctly set up in the system.
- Check the customizing settings in the relevant IMG (Implementation Guide) paths.
Authorization Check:
- Ensure that the user encountering the error has the necessary authorizations to access the equipment packages. This can be checked with the help of your SAP security team.
Technical Troubleshooting:
- If the issue persists, consider checking for any system logs or dumps that may provide more insight into the error.
- You can use transaction
ST22
to check for dumps orSM21
for system logs.Consult SAP Notes:
-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that may address this specific error message. There may be patches or updates available that resolve known issues.
Contact SAP Support:
- If you are unable to resolve the issue with the above steps, consider reaching out to SAP Support for further assistance. Provide them with the error message details and any relevant logs or screenshots.
